The Office of Elections and County Clerks of Hawaiʻi remind voters that today, Monday, Oct. 10, 2016, is the deadline to register to vote in the November 8th General Election.

To be eligible to register to vote, you must be a US Citizen, a resident of Hawaii and at least 18 years old.

Registration can be done by 4:30 p.m. online or in person at the County Clerk’s office.

Voters who have moved or changed their name since the last election will need to update their voter registration.
